The Stefan-Boltzmann Law describes the power radiated from a black body in terms of its temperature. Specifically, the Stefan-Boltzmann law states that the total energy radiated per unit surface area of a black body across all wavelengths per uni time, `j^("*")`, is directly proportional to the fourth power of the black body's thermodynamic temperature. To find the total power radiated from an object, multiply by its surface area:
`P=AepsilonsigmaT^4`, where:
